Over time, NAND flash cells degrade and develop "bad blocks." The SMI MPtool can perform a thorough scan of the entire NAND chip, identify these problematic blocks, and build a new bad block table. At its core, the MPtool operates below the operating system level, directly communicating with the controller chip. When a standard operating system cannot recognize a corrupted USB drive, the MPtool can often detect it by placing the controller into a special "ROM mode" or low-level state. From there, the tool can reload fresh firmware, remap the device's internal bad block table, and perform a complete low-level format, effectively restoring a "bricked" or malfunctioning device to a working condition. SMI MPTool (SM32x/SM34x) isn't your average consumer software. It is a powerful factory-grade "Mass Production" tool designed for Silicon Motion USB controllers. For the average user, it’s often the last line of defense for a "dead" USB drive that shows a "No Media" error or has a corrupted file system.
